London City Airport terminal awarded air quality certificate
London City Airport is pleased to confirm that following a comprehensive on–site survey carried out by Green Air Monitoring, it has been awarded a certificate of compliance for indoor air quality in its terminal building.
The Green Air Monitoring survey showed that none of the components associated with contamination from aircraft or vehicle exhausts have affected the airport’s facility to any degree. Both nitrogen oxide and carbon monoxide levels are well below the respective workplace exposure limits. These findings demonstrate that London City Airport is fully compliant with air quality limits for the workplace.
The airport has had in place a comprehensive air quality monitoring and management programme throughout the airport for a number of years, being awarded this certificate gives external verification of the airport’s efforts.
London City Airport takes very seriously the health, safety and wellbeing of all passengers, staff and other contractors in the airport terminal. The results of this air quality report are welcomed by the airport.
